ComfyUI-Image-Saver插件中Lora哈希信息导入问题解析
在ComfyUI-Image-Saver插件的使用过程中,部分用户遇到了Lora模型哈希信息无法正确导入到生成图片元数据的问题。本文将深入分析这一现象的原因及解决方案。
问题现象
当用户通过ImpactWildcardEncode节点生成图片时,虽然Lora模型是从CivitAI平台最新下载的,但生成的图片元数据中却未能正确包含Lora的哈希信息。这种情况会导致图片上传到CivitAI平台时无法自动识别使用的Lora模型。
问题根源分析
经过技术验证,该问题可能由以下几个因素导致:
-
缓存问题:ComfyUI可能缓存了旧版本的Lora模型信息,即使重新下载了相同名称的模型,系统仍可能读取缓存数据。
-
模型文件损坏:下载过程中可能出现文件传输错误,导致模型文件不完整。
-
节点配置问题:ImpactWildcardEncode节点的参数设置可能影响哈希信息的写入。
解决方案
针对这一问题,我们推荐以下解决步骤:
-
完全删除并重新下载Lora模型:
- 首先彻底删除原有的Lora模型文件
- 从CivitAI平台重新下载最新版本
- 确保下载过程无中断
-
刷新ComfyUI缓存:
- 重启ComfyUI服务
- 使用"Refresh"功能重新加载模型列表
-
验证工作流配置:
- 确保ImpactWildcardEncode节点正确连接到工作流
- 检查Lora名称格式是否正确(包括权重参数)
-
元数据验证:
- 生成图片后,使用元数据查看工具确认哈希信息是否已写入
- 检查PNG文件的EXIF信息
技术原理
ComfyUI-Image-Saver插件通过解析模型文件的特定标识信息生成哈希值,并将这些信息写入图片元数据。当模型文件发生变化或读取异常时,这一过程可能失败。正确的哈希信息对于模型溯源和版本管理至关重要。
最佳实践建议
- 定期清理模型缓存
- 下载模型后验证文件完整性
- 使用标准化的Lora命名格式
- 在重要生成前测试元数据写入功能
通过以上方法,用户可以确保Lora模型信息正确记录在生成图片中,便于后续的管理和使用。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



